HELP - Renting lens need by Friday
Anyone have a suggestion as to where I might be able to rent a 24mm for canon 7d? I'll be doing a wedding, large group and would like to go this route. Will need to order Wednesday to ensure overnight delivery. HELP please.

Have you tried http://www.borrowlenses.com/category/canon_wide_angle

I put an order in to rent camera body and lens the other day. One item to note is that they require images of license, credit card and one other proof of identification at order time the first time you order from them. Easy to do, take photos - web quality - and upload at that time.
